Question: the mucosa of my lips are scaling off everyday. I had a bad habit of chewing on my lips.do I have oral cancer? i'm 22 yrs old and i've stopped chewing on my lips but this persists...it started maybe a yr ago....

Answer: I suspect that what is scaling away is the "vermillion" of the lips; the bit that shows with the mouth closed. The mucosa is inside the mouth. If your lips are peeling, I doubt it would be oral cancer. If you have any chronic irritation of the structures inside the mouth, then there is a risk of oral cancer. I suggest that you consult a dentist, if you have not had a teeth checkup for a while, as they are trained in examination for oral cancers, as are doctors.
